Ingredients You’ll Need
The ingredients list here is refreshingly simple yet essential for crafting that perfect harmony of flavors and textures. Each component plays a vital role, whether adding creaminess, crunch, sweetness, or a subtle bite that rounds out the salad beautifully.
- 1 lb cooked chopped chicken: The hearty protein base that makes this salad substantial and satisfying.
- ⅔ cup chopped apple: Adds a sweet, crisp freshness that contrasts so well with the savory elements.
- ⅓ cup finely diced yellow onion: Brings a mild sharpness that livens up the overall flavor.
- 1 celery stalk (chopped): Provides a refreshing crunch and a clean flavor.
- ¾ cup mayo: The creamy binder that makes the salad luscious and smooth.
- ⅛ teaspoon table salt: Enhances all the flavors, with extra added to taste.
- ⅛ teaspoon ground black pepper: Adds a gentle spice and depth, adjustable to preference.
- Bread or croissants: Ideal for serving, lending a buttery or wholesome canvas to enjoy the salad.
- Lettuce (optional): For extra crunch and freshness when making sandwiches.
Directions
Step 1: In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ooked chopped chicken, chopped apple, finely diced yellow onion, and chopped celery. This is where the fresh and crunchy textures start to build up, so make sure the apple and celery pieces are bite-sized but distinct.
Step 2: Add the ¾ cup of mayo, then sprinkle in the salt and ground black pepper. Stir everything gently but thoroughly until all ingredients are evenly coated in the creamy dressing. This step is where the magic happens, blending creaminess with crispness beautifully.
Step 3: Taste your salad and adjust the salt and pepper to your liking. Don’t be shy here—seasoning is key to bringing all these flavors alive.
Step 4: For the best flavor and texture, cover the bowl with plastic wrap and chill the salad in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es. Letting it rest allows the flavors to marry perfectly and helps the salad firm up slightly, making it easier to scoop or sandwich later.
Step 5: Serve cold on your choice of sliced bread, buttery croissants, or buns. Adding some crisp lettuce inside the sandwich adds a lovely extra crunch and freshness. Alternatively, scoop the creamy chicken salad onto your favorite crackers for a light snack or appetizer.

Variations
One of my favorite things about this Creamy Chicken Salad with Apple and Celery Recipe is how easy it is to tweak to fit different tastes or dietary needs. For example, if you prefer a tangy twist, swapping half the mayo with Greek yogurt adds a lovely brightness and reduces the richness slightly. If you’re avoiding dairy or eggs, try a vegan mayo to keep the creamy texture intact without compromising flavor.
For a gluten-free makeover, simply serve the chicken salad on gluten-free bread, crisp lettuce cups, or crackers. And if you want to change up the crunch factor, I sometimes swap celery for chopped toasted walnuts or pecans to add a nutty depth. Another great option is to add dried cranberries or raisins for a sweet surprise that plays off the apple beautifully.
If you’re looking to add more herbs or flavor layers, fresh tarragon, dill, or even a touch of curry powder in the dressing can transform this salad into a new taste experience. The beauty of this recipe is how it adapts well to different cooking methods—sometimes I poach the chicken for extra tenderness, or use leftover rotisserie chicken for convenience without sacrificing taste.
Storage and Reheating
Storing Leftovers
After enjoying the initial meal, I always store any leftover chicken sal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It keeps best in a shallow container to ensure even cooling, and you can safely store it for up to 3 days. Make sure the container has a tight seal to prevent the salad from absorbing any other fridge odors and to keep it tasting fresh.
Freezing
I typically don’t recommend freezing this chicken salad because the mayo and fresh ingredients like apple and celery don’t freeze well—they tend to become watery or mushy upon thawing. If you do want to freeze cooked chicken for convenience, I suggest freezing it separately before making the salad fresh each time for the best texture and flavor.
Reheating
This salad is best enjoyed cold or at room temperature, so reheating is unnecessary and not advised since warm mayo-based salads can separate and lose their appealing texture. If you prefer a warm chicken option, consider serving it fresh or simply warming the chicken separately before assembling the salad without mayo and then adding the dressing just before serving.
FAQs
Can I use rotisserie chicken for this recipe?
Absolutely! Using rotisserie chicken is a fantastic shortcut that adds great flavor and saves prep time. Just make sure to chop it into bite-sized pieces before combining with the other ingredients.
What type of apple works best in this chicken salad?
I love using crisp, slightly tart apples like Granny Smith or Fuji because they hold their shape well and add a nice contrast of sweet and tangy flavors without becoming mushy.
Can I make this salad ahead of time?
Yes, making this chicken salad a few hours or even the day before serving is ideal. Letting it chill allows the flavors to meld beautifully and gives the salad a more cohesive taste and texture.
Is there a lighter alternative to mayo I can use?
Definitely! You can substitute part or all of the mayo with Greek yogurt for a lighter, tangier version. Just note that it will be less rich but still creamy and delicious.
How should I serve this salad for a party?
I often serve it as an elegant appetizer by spooning small portions onto cucumber rounds or crisp crackers, garnished with fresh herbs. It’s also great for buffet spreads as sandwich sliders or in lettuce wraps for a crowd-pleasing bite.

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 1 lb cooked chopped chicken
- ⅔ cup chopped apple
- ⅓ cup finely diced yellow onion
- 1 celery stalk, chopped
- ¾ cup mayonnaise
- ⅛ teaspoon table salt (plus more to taste)
- ⅛ teaspoon ground black pepper (plus more to taste)
- Bread or croissants for making sandwiches
- Lettuce for sandwiches (optional)
Instructions
- Combine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ooked chopped chicken, chopped apple, finely diced yellow onion, chopped celery, mayo, salt, and black pepper. Stir thoroughly until all the ingredients are well mixed and evenly coated with the mayonnaise.
- Chill the Salad: Cover the mixture and refrigerate it for at least 30 minutes. This resting time allows the flavors to meld together, resulting in a more flavorful chicken salad.
- Serve: Once chilled, taste the salad and adjust salt and pepper as needed. Serve cold on sliced bread, croissants, or buns to make sandwiches. Alternatively, scoop the salad with crackers for a light snack. Optionally, add lettuce to sandwiches for extra crunch and freshness.
Notes
- Using tart apple varieties like Granny Smith adds a nice crispness and a tart contrast to the creamy mayo.
- Chicken can be leftover roasted or poached chicken; using fresh cooked chicken is best for texture.
- To make the salad more vibrant, you can add a squeeze of lemon juice to prevent the apple from browning.
- This salad can be stored covered in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
- Lettuce is optional but recommended if making sandwiches for added texture and freshness.
